How to help your artists - The circle of influence.
So over the past 10-15 years, as Iāve been trying to branch out, grow a following and sell commissions, thereās one phrase Iāve heard more than any other.
āIād love to support you, but I have no money.ā
And you know, I get that. I understand. I donāt have any either. But hereās the secret. The most powerful and useful thing you can do to support an artist? It doesnāt cost a penny. Reblog their posts, signal boost their commissions, advertise their patreon./ If you have commissioned them, or do support their patreon? Write a review, tell your friends, share their links. Keep circulating the tapes.
Every post is an artist laying themselves bare before you. You have the power to make them into somebody. You can make them into a big name, you can help bring them an income. All you have to do is share.
Hereās a handy infographic.
If artists get only likes, they never get any exposure. They find no followers, they make no money, and feel worthless.
But with reblogs, who knows how far they could reach? New people could see their work and follow them, and maybe one person will spot that commissions post or patreon promo, and maybe offer to help support them. And it didnāt even cost those followers a penny to reblog the post.
So please, anyone out there. If you enjoy an artistās work and canāt afford to give any monetary support, you can give them something more powerful. A voice.
